Not at all. However I don't pulverize my body with standard deadlifts and squats anymore. For the past two years I have chosen from leg press, hack squat, glute-ham raises, hip thrusts, and lunges, and split squats, obviously not all in the same workout. I go all out still and I maintained my leg mass just as good as with the other exercises, possibly even improving my hamstrings.
For this week's leg workout, I did:
Glute-ham raise
Walking lunges
Hip thrusts
Dumbbell stiff-legged deadlift
Lower body training is good for overall health and staving off back pain, if done correctly.
I've come to think standard squats and deadlifts are grossly overrated in regards to other exercises if muscle growth is the goal. Plus they just can burn you out.
